数字量输入中NPN 漏型输入(Sink)与PNP 源型输入(Source)型传感器的区别
2025-04-01 17:51:01
钡铼技术
数字量输入中NPN 漏型输入(Sink)与PNP 源型输入(Source)型传感器的区别
1. 核心工作原理对比
类型 | 晶体管结构 | 电流流向 | 输出电平逻辑 |
---|---|---|---|
NPN | 负极-正极-负极型三极管 | 电流从负载→传感器→GND(漏电流) | 导通时输出低电平(0V) |
PNP | 正极-负极-正极型三极管 | 电流从电源→传感器→负载(源电流) | 导通时输出高电平(电源电压) |
等效电路图示:
NPN型: PNP型: +Vcc +Vcc | | [负载] [负载] | | OUT←─┤ NPN OUT─→┤ PNP │ │ GND GND
2. 电气特性差异
参数 | NPN传感器 | PNP传感器 |
---|---|---|
输出电平 | 导通: 0V;断开: 高阻态 | 导通: +Vcc;断开: 高阻态 |
接线方式 | 需接漏型输入(Sink) | 需接源型输入(Source) |
抗干扰 | 更抗负向干扰 | 更抗正向干扰 |
常见电压 | 12/24V DC(工业标准) | 12/24V DC |
3. 工业接线标准
NPN接PLC漏型输入:
传感器棕色线(+Vcc) → +24V 传感器蓝色线(GND) → GND 传感器黑色线(OUT) → PLC输入点 PLC的COM端 → +24V //关键区别点
PNP接PLC源型输入:
传感器棕色线(+Vcc) → +24V 传感器蓝色线(GND) → GND 传感器黑色线(OUT) → PLC输入点 PLC的COM端 → GND //关键区别点
注意:错误接线会导致PLC无法检测信号或短路!
4. 选型决策指南
graph TD A[PLC输入类型?] -->|漏型(Sink)| B[选NPN] A -->|源型(Source)| C[选PNP] B --> D{需要安全低电平?} D -->|是| E[优先NPN(故障时归零)] D -->|否| F[根据库存选择] C --> G{需要直接驱动继电器?} G -->|是| H[优先PNP(高电平驱动)]
5. 典型应用场景
场景 | 推荐类型 | 理由 |
---|---|---|
安全回路急停 | NPN | 故障时强制归零更安全 |
直接驱动继电器 | PNP | 高电平输出减少驱动电路 |
日系PLC(三菱) | NPN | 日系PLC多默认漏型输入 |
欧系PLC(西门子) | PNP | 欧系设备常用源型输入 |
6. 常见问题处理
问题1:NPN传感器接源型PLC无反应
原因:电流路径不完整
解决:在PLC输入与+24V间加1kΩ上拉电阻
问题2:PNP传感器导致PLC输入常亮
原因:COM端误接+24V
解决:将COM端改接GND
问题3:干扰导致误触发
对策:
NPN型:在信号线对GND加100nF电容
PNP型:在信号线对+Vcc加100nF电容
7. 信号波形对比
状态 | NPN输出波形 | PNP输出波形 |
---|---|---|
导通时 | 0V(低电平) | +24V(高电平) |
断开时 | 高阻态(悬空) | 高阻态(悬空) |
示波器显示 | 脉冲下沿触发 | 脉冲上沿触发 |
8. 国际标准差异
地区 | 主流类型 | 典型设备 |
---|---|---|
中国/日本 | NPN | 三菱FX系列、欧姆龙CP1E |
欧洲 | PNP | 西门子S7-1200、倍加福传感器 |
北美 | 混合使用 | AB CompactLogix |
总结
本质区别:
NPN是"低电平有效",电流从负载流向传感器
PNP是"高电平有效",电流从传感器流向负载
选型口诀:
"日系NPN,欧系PNP;安全选NPN,驱动选PNP"兼容方案:
使用双向光耦隔离模块(如TLP281-4)可兼容两种类型